Export exemption from inspection is an important measure taken by the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ine of China to implement the strategy of winning by quality, encourage the export of high-quality products, promote the expansion of national brands into international markets, transform the growth mode of foreign trade, and enhance the competitiveness of the “Made in China” market. It is a high-quality honor awarded to export enterprises by the country and represents a high level of industry. Therefore, “National Export Exemption from Inspection” is also known as the “* * passport” to the international market.

Enterprises that have obtained the qualification for export exemption from inspection are exempt from inspection when exporting exempted goods, and can directly clear customs and release them. This not only exempts them from inspection fees, saves customs clearance time and costs, but also allows them to enjoy convenient measures for inspection and quarantine clearance. Therefore, the country has strict admission conditions for export inspection free enterprises, with high requirements, strict standards, and tight control. It is considered to be one of the strictest quality reviews currently available. Currently, only over 100 enterprises in various industries across the country have obtained export inspection exemption qualifications
